| PSRD: Timeline of Martian Volcanism (ppt) | The work confirms previous findings by others that volcanism was continuous throughout Martian geologic history until about one to two hundred million years ago, the final volcanic events were not synchronous across the planet, and the latest large-scale caldera activity ended about 150 million years ago in the Tharsis province. |

| Evolution of Our Solar System | This series of illustrations are part of an exhibit depicting the formation and evolution of the planets and moons in our solar system. | | Planetary Demolition Derby (Artist Concept) | This artist's concept shows a celestial body about the size of our moon slamming at great speed into a body the size of Mercury. NASA's Spitzer Space Telescope found evidence that a high-speed collision of this sort occurred a few thousand years ago around a young star, called HD 172555, still in the early stages of planet formation. | | Gas Giants Form Quickly (Artist Concept) | This is an artist's concept of a hypothetical 10-million-year-old star system. The bright blur at the center is a star much like our sun. The other orb in the image is a gas-giant planet like Jupiter. Wisps of white throughout the image represent traces of gas. Astronomers using NASA's Spitzer Space Telescope have found evidence showing that gas-giant planets either form within the first 10 million years of a sun-like star's life, or not at all. |

| Clues About Mars Evolution Revealed | Lapen and his colleagues' data showed that the true age of Mars meteorite ALH84001 is 4.091 billion years old, about 400 million years younger than earlier age estimates. They concluded that this stone formed during an important time when Mars was wet and had a magnetic field, conditions that are favorable for the development of simple life. | | The Early Earth and Plate Tectonics | The Earth is formed by accretion of spatial particulates and large masses and eventually forms an outer crust.
